1982 Dodge Omni vs. 2005 Toyota Mega Cruiser
To start off, 2005 Toyota Mega Cruiser is newer by 23 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1982 Dodge Omni.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1982 Dodge Omni would be higher. At 4,164 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 Toyota Mega Cruiser is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Toyota Mega Cruiser weights approximately 1861 kg more than 1982 Dodge Omni.
Because 2005 Toyota Mega Cruiser is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1982 Dodge Omni.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Toyota Mega Cruiser will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
